WHAT IS MICRONEEDLING?

Microneedling is a minimally invasive skin treatment that uses tiny, controlled micro-injuries to stimulate your skin’s natural healing process. These small punctures encourage your body to produce more collagen and elastin, the building blocks that keep your skin smooth, firm, and youthful.


When performed with medical-grade devices in a professional setting, microneedling is FDA-cleared and considered safe for most people.

POSSIBLE RISKS OF MICRONEEDLING

Like any cosmetic procedure, microneedling has some risks, but most are minor and temporary when performed correctly.


Common, Short-Term Microneedling Side Effects

Within the first 24 to 48 hours after microneedling, many people experience:

  • Mild redness similar to a sunburn

  • Slight swelling or sensitivity

  • Temporary dryness or flaking.

These side effects are generally mild and fade quickly, leaving your skin looking refreshed.


Risks with Improper Technique or Unsafe Settings

As safe as microneedling is when done properly, there can be significant risks when microneedling is done by someone without proper training or with equipment that isn’t appropriately sterilized, including:

  • Infection from unsterilized needles or due to poor aftercare instructions

  • Scarring or pigmentation changes may occur if the device is used incorrectly

  • Excessive bleeding if performed on someone taking blood thinners or with underlying medical issues like autoimmune disease

  • Delayed healing if underlying health issues aren’t taken into account


Microneedling can also spread infections, such as acne or cold sores, to individuals with skin problems like eczema or psoriasis. That’s why a thorough review of your medical history is a key part of how we determine whether microneedling is right for you!

WHAT IS THE MICRONEEDLING PROCESS?

One of the best parts about microneedling is how simple and straightforward the process is. At Anderson Family Dental, we’ll guide you through every step so you feel comfortable and confident.


Before Your Appointment

We’ll start with a consultation to discuss your goals, review your medical history, and make sure microneedling is the right fit for you. In many cases, this conversation may happen as part of your consultation for other cosmetic dentistry procedures or during your routine dental cleaning


In the days leading up to your appointment, we may recommend avoiding retinol creams, excessive sun exposure, or certain medications that can increase sensitivity.


During Your Appointment

You’ll relax in our pristine dental office while we gently clean your skin and apply a topical numbing cream. Most patients say the treatment feels like light scratching or tingling, but numbing cream makes it very tolerable. 


The handheld device creates controlled, microscopic channels in the skin. This takes about 20–30 minutes, depending on the size of the treatment area. Afterward, we may apply a calming serum or growth-factor product to enhance results and soothe your skin.


After Your Appointment

Your skin may look slightly red or flushed, similar to a mild sunburn. This usually subsides within 24 to 48 hours. We’ll provide easy-to-follow instructions, such as avoiding heavy makeup, skipping the gym for a day or two, and using gentle, hydrating skincare products.


Within a few days, your skin will start to look brighter and more refreshed. Over the following weeks, as your body produces more collagen and elastin, you’ll notice a smoother texture, reduced fine lines, and an overall healthy glow.


Long-Term Benefits

Most patients see the best results after a series of treatments, usually spaced 4–6 weeks apart. With proper skincare and sun protection, the improvements can last for months and even continue to build over time.
